Ajouter mois ou année à une date

  • Initiateur de la discussion Initiateur de la discussion madlolo
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

M

madlolo

Guest
Bonjour à tous,

je désire ajouter (retrancher) un nombre de mois ou d'années à une date.
Tout le monde sait qu'on peut le faire avec des jours.
Ex : 31/12/2009 + 1 = 01/01/2010
Or je voudrais le faire avec des mois : 31/12/2009 + 1 mois = 31/01/2010

Je voudrais simplement éviter de contourner le problème en remplaçant les mois par des jours :
31/12/2009 + 1*30
Y a t'il une fonction Excel du type "DateAdd("31/01/2009"; "m"; 1)" : ajouter un mois au 31/12/2009 ?

Merci d'avance,
 
Re : Ajouter mois ou année à une date

Bonjour le Forum,
Bonjour madlolo,

si ta date est en A1 en B1 tu peux faire =DATE(ANNEE(A1);MOIS(A1)+1;JOUR(A1))

et si tu ne veux pas l'écrire en dure dans ta formule tu peux faire quelque chose du style :

Date en A1 nombre de Mois a ajouter en B1

et en C1 la formule : =DATE(ANNEE(A1);MOIS(A1)+B1;JOUR(A1))

Jocelyn
 
Re : Ajouter mois ou année à une date

Bonjour madlolo,

Ta date en A1 : =DATE(ANNEE(A1);MOIS(A1)+1;JOUR(A1))

Ici rajoute un mois, mais tu peux faire pareil pour les années.

Tu peux remplacer le +1 par une cellule contenant cette valeur.

Bonne journée.

Jean-Pierre

Edit : Bonjour Jocelyn
 
Re : Ajouter mois ou année à une date

Bonjour à tous,

En activant la macro complémentaire Utilitaire d'analyse :

Code:
=MOIS.DECALER(A1;12)

avantage : gère les années bissextiles :

le 29/02/2008 + 12 mois donne le 28/02/2009

@+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Retour